How to Find a Salvation Army Lodge Close to Rockport, Texas

The Salvation Army is an evangelical movement that is part of the universal Christian Church. The movement was started in 1852 by William Booth in London, England. Booth preached the gospel of Jesus to the poor and hungry in the streets of London -- much to the annoyance of the more traditional church leaders in London at the time. Salvation Army lodges are places for individuals and families to go if they have suddenly found themselves homeless. The lodges provide food, shelter, counseling and spiritual care.
